Two routes, one trip

Quick Escape runs one of two ways, and your captain picks on the morning of day one based on wind and swell:

The western route — Cayos Limones and Chichime, with a run out to the Cayos Holandeses reef. Shorter crossings, the classic postcard cays, and a first taste of the outer reef.
The eastern route — Coco Blanco, Coco Bandero and Isla Verde, with a run out to Holandeses. Longer sailing, remoter anchorages, and the cays most three-night charters never attempt.

Neither is the better one. They're the right answer to different weeks.

Day by day

Day 1 — Board and go

Aboard at 10:00 after the overland transfer from Panama City. Briefing, cabins, and underway before lunch. First anchorage chosen on the day. Afternoon in the water, first sundowner on deck.

Day 2 — The cays

A morning sail east and a full day out of the crowd. Snorkelling, kayaks through the shallows between the cays, and lunch built around whatever the fishermen brought alongside. Evening ashore on a beach with nobody on it.

Day 3 — Out to the reef

A run to the Cayos Holandeses — the outer reef of the archipelago, where the wall drops off into open Caribbean. Snorkelling in the best water of the trip, then a slow sail back west to the last anchorage.

Departure — 07:00

Coffee at anchor, then back to Cartí for the morning transfer to Panama City.
